GRAND ROYALE APARTMENT COMPLEX & SPA



Benefits and Services
Grand Royale Apartment Complex & Spa is a great choice for travelers who want to combine a mountain holiday, comfortable accommodation in spacious apartments, and a relaxing spa atmosphere. The hotel is especially well suited for families with children, couples, and guests planning skiing in Bansko during winter or peaceful walks around the Pirin area in the warmer season. The complex is located in a quiet part of Bansko, at the foot of the Pirin Mountains, not far from the gondola lift and the resort center. The accommodation format is particularly convenient for guests who value space, separate sleeping areas, and the feel of an apartment hotel rather than a standard compact room. The hotel’s main advantages include a 20-meter indoor pool, a full spa area, a restaurant serving breakfast, dinner, and a la carte options, a cozy lobby bar, a kids’ club, and winter shuttle service to the first gondola station. It is a comfortable option for travelers who appreciate spacious apartments, family-friendly facilities, and a beautiful mountain setting. The hotel offers Studio, One-Bedroom Apartment, and Two-Bedroom Apartment categories. The Studio measures around 40 m² and accommodates up to 2+1; the one-bedroom apartment is about 55 m² and suits up to 3+1; the two-bedroom apartment is approximately 80 m² and can host up to 5+1. Based on the overall layout of the complex and the apartment style, guests can expect pleasant views of the mountains, garden, or internal area, while the exact view depends on the specific unit assigned. According to the official information, the hotel focuses on breakfast, dinner, and menu service. The restaurant operates from 07:00 to 22:00; breakfast is served from 07:00 to 10:00, dinner from 18:30 to 21:00, and room service is available from 10:00 to 22:00. Breakfast includes dairy products from local farms, cereals, homemade pastries, seasonal fruit and vegetables, coffee, tea, other hot drinks, post-mix juices, filtered water, and oat milk; children’s purées, porridge, and biscuits are also mentioned. Dinner is offered in a buffet / set menu format, while drinks during dinner are not included. Throughout the day, guests can also enjoy a la carte dishes from Bulgarian and European cuisine. Amenities vary by category, but in general guests will find a living room with sofa, SMART TV or LCD TV, air conditioning in the living room, individually controlled heating, a balcony, terrace, or direct garden access, a minibar, microwave, toaster, electric kettle, telephone, clothes drying rack, hairdryer, bathrobes and slippers, toiletries, and a bathroom with shower. The apartments also include a table with chairs, dishes, and cups, while the Two-Bedroom Apartment has an additional second toilet. Formally, the units include a kitchenette, but the hotel separately notes that they are not intended for full self-catering. There is a restaurant and a lobby bar on site. The restaurant serves breakfast, dinner, and a la carte dishes; the cuisine focuses on Bulgarian and European specialties, and the description also highlights fresh products from local suppliers and a carefully selected wine list. The lobby bar is open from 11:00 to 23:00 and offers aromatic coffee, desserts, wine, and signature cocktails. According to the published menu, guests can order hot drinks, soft drinks, fresh juices, lemonades, milkshakes, beer, wine, as well as a wide choice of spirits and cocktails based on vodka, tequila, rum, whisky, gin, and other categories. The hotel focuses on combining spa relaxation with active leisure in the surrounding area. In the warmer season, nearby activities include forest trails, eco routes, hikes to mountain huts and panoramic peaks, as well as ATV, mountain biking, climbing, and rafting. In winter, the proximity to the ski area and the shuttle to the first gondola station is especially convenient. On site, guests can also enjoy an indoor pool, fitness area, spa, and massage treatments. For children, the hotel provides a kid’s club and a playground. The kids’ club operates from 09:00 to 20:00 and is equipped with toys, books, and educational materials; there is also a safe play zone on site. The playground is open all day, located next to the restaurant, and features natural grass. The hotel also mentions evening movie screenings for children from 20:00, while children’s animation is available according to the hotel schedule. Another plus for families is the children’s section in the pool and the presence of purées, porridge, and biscuits at breakfast. The property features a 20-meter indoor pool with a children’s section and water temperature of around 30–32°C, a relaxation area by the pool, and a spa zone with Finnish sauna, aroma sauna, infrared sauna, steam bath, hammam, warm jacuzzi, salt room, and fitness area. The spa area operates from 10:00 to 20:00, while the pool is open from 09:00 to 20:00. Guests also have access to Wi-Fi, outdoor parking, a safe at reception, a children’s room, playground, ski storage, and an organized winter shuttle to the first gondola station. Close to the hotel, guests can easily visit Bansko Ski Resort at approximately 0.6 km, Bansko Gondola Lift at around 1.2 km, the Museum of Otets Paisii Hilendarski at about 1.3 km, Velyanova House and the House Museum of Neofit Rilski at around 1.4 km, the Holy Trinity Church at about 1.7–1.9 km, as well as the House Museum of Nikola Vaptsarov at approximately 1.7 km.
